WebThe binary representation of 20 is 10100 3. Using Built-in methods In C++, we can use the bitset () member function from the std::bitset namespace, which can construct a bitset container object from the integer argument. In Java, we can use the Integer.toBinaryString () method, which returns the specified integer's string representation. WebOutput. Enter a binary number: 1101 1101 in binary = 13 in decimal. In the program, we have included the header file cmath to perform mathematical operations in the program. …
Bitwise Operators in C/C++ - GeeksforGeeks
WebYou can use std::bitset to convert a number to its binary format. Use the following code snippet: std::string binary = std::bitset<8> (n).to_string (); Share Improve this answer Follow answered Mar 7, 2015 at 19:31 Nilutpal Borgohain 386 2 9 4 That only answers one third of the question. – Jonathan Wakely Mar 9, 2015 at 12:06 3 WebOct 23, 2011 · With every iteration, the most significant bit is being read from the byte by shifting it and binary comparing with 1. For example, let's assume that input value is 128, what binary translates to 1000 0000. Shifting it by 7 will give 0000 0001, so it concludes that the most significant bit was 1. 0000 0001 & 1 = 1. marcellin nachin
Print binary representation of a number – C, C++, Java, and …
WebAfter choosing them, you calculate the value of the chosen pair of substrings as follows: let s 1 be the first substring, s 2 be the second chosen substring, and f ( s i) be the integer such that s i is its binary representation (for example, if s i is 11010, f ( s i) = 26 ); the value is the bitwise OR of f ( s 1) and f ( s 2). WebFor the second bit, the result is 0. We simply have to sum up the result at every step. The sum gives us the decimal number. C++ Program to Convert Binary Number to Decimal. … WebDec 16, 2015 · Looks like c/c++/c#, if so you have shifting.. just loop to N-1 bits from 0 and use sum+= (value>>i)&1 Ie: you always check the last/right most bit but move the binary representation of the number to the right for every iteration until you have no more bits to check. Also, think about signed/unsigned and any integer format. csa travel protection regs